The 18-day museum
In 1940, our army’s military campaign only lasted 18 days.
18 days in the course of five years of imprisonment and occupation.
The museum’s thousands of objects and numerous period documents will give us a vision of the war.
The museum exhibits the different tragic and happy episodes that our regional populations lived through.
For the pilgrim of the battles, the museum may be a true transition between Normandy and the Ardennes. It will be both informative for the visitor and interesting for the collector.
